Hi

 

Missions 3 5 and 10 are indeed cold starts.

 

When assessing this other things to consider is mission length. Also especially when scripting for a wingman for some reason they will be ready and gone in no time and we have to put them in orbit whilst they wait for you to go through a full start up procedure . So even that feels a little strange always having your wingman waiting around rather than flying off with him initially.

 

That said I take your point . In the 15 mission campaign I am building now, "Rise of the Persian Lion" I will consider giving an option at the end of every successful mission to select the next mission as a hot start or a cold start . So hopefully keep everybody happy.

 

Thanks for your thoughts

Can we get the option to auto-pass missions? Mission #1 is getting dull just doing an airshow and failing because I went outside the silly 3 mile limit. It's kinda dull.

 

There should be no reason to go outside the 3 mile zone and keep north of the runway. Set way point 6 which is the centre of the runway you will have a constant read out of your distance from the runway at all times. Easy to keep within 3 miles and just keep north of runway. It’s a test of flying control.

If you want to bypass you could always play through mission editor and locate the mission files and play any one of the missions at any time.

 

Hope this helps
